To solve the problems involving adding fractions with unlike denominators, we need to follow these steps:

Steps to Add Fractions with Unlike Denominators:


1. Find the Least Common Denominator (LCD): The LCD is the smallest number that both denominators can divide into evenly.
2. Adjust the fractions: Rewrite each fraction with the LCD as the denominator by multiplying both the numerator and the denominator of each fraction by the necessary factor.
3. Add the numerators: Once the denominators are the same, add the numerators and keep the denominator the same.
4. Simplify the result: Reduce the resulting fraction to its simplest form if possible.

Let's solve each problem step by step.

---

Problem 1: $\frac{2}{5} + \frac{3}{4}$



1. Find the LCD: The denominators are 5 and 4. The LCD is 20.
2. Adjust the fractions:
- $\frac{2}{5} = \frac{2 \times 4}{5 \times 4} = \frac{8}{20}$
- $\frac{3}{4} = \frac{3 \times 5}{4 \times 5} = \frac{15}{20}$
3. Add the numerators:
$$
\frac{8}{20} + \frac{15}{20} = \frac{8 + 15}{20} = \frac{23}{20}
$$
4. Simplify: $\frac{23}{20}$ is already in simplest form.

Answer: $\frac{23}{20}$

---

Problem 2: $\frac{1}{8} + \frac{4}{5}$



1. Find the LCD: The denominators are 8 and 5. The LCD is 40.
2. Adjust the fractions:
- $\frac{1}{8} = \frac{1 \times 5}{8 \times 5} = \frac{5}{40}$
- $\frac{4}{5} = \frac{4 \times 8}{5 \times 8} = \frac{32}{40}$
3. Add the numerators:
$$
\frac{5}{40} + \frac{32}{40} = \frac{5 + 32}{40} = \frac{37}{40}
$$
4. Simplify: $\frac{37}{40}$ is already in simplest form.

Answer: $\frac{37}{40}$

---

Problem 3: $\frac{5}{6} + \frac{2}{3}$



1. Find the LCD: The denominators are 6 and 3. The LCD is 6.
2. Adjust the fractions:
- $\frac{5}{6}$ remains $\frac{5}{6}$.
- $\frac{2}{3} = \frac{2 \times 2}{3 \times 2} = \frac{4}{6}$
3. Add the numerators:
$$
\frac{5}{6} + \frac{4}{6} = \frac{5 + 4}{6} = \frac{9}{6}
$$
4. Simplify: $\frac{9}{6} = \frac{3}{2}$.

Answer: $\frac{3}{2}$

---

Problem 4: $\frac{4}{5} + \frac{1}{4}$



1. Find the LCD: The denominators are 5 and 4. The LCD is 20.
2. Adjust the fractions:
- $\frac{4}{5} = \frac{4 \times 4}{5 \times 4} = \frac{16}{20}$
- $\frac{1}{4} = \frac{1 \times 5}{4 \times 5} = \frac{5}{20}$
3. Add the numerators:
$$
\frac{16}{20} + \frac{5}{20} = \frac{16 + 5}{20} = \frac{21}{20}
$$
4. Simplify: $\frac{21}{20}$ is already in simplest form.

Answer: $\frac{21}{20}$

---

Problem 5: $\frac{6}{8} + \frac{5}{6}$



1. Find the LCD: The denominators are 8 and 6. The LCD is 24.
2. Adjust the fractions:
- $\frac{6}{8} = \frac{6 \times 3}{8 \times 3} = \frac{18}{24}$
- $\frac{5}{6} = \frac{5 \times 4}{6 \times 4} = \frac{20}{24}$
3. Add the numerators:
$$
\frac{18}{24} + \frac{20}{24} = \frac{18 + 20}{24} = \frac{38}{24}
$$
4. Simplify: $\frac{38}{24} = \frac{19}{12}$.

Answer: $\frac{19}{12}$

---

Problem 6: $\frac{1}{10} + \frac{3}{5}$



1. Find the LCD: The denominators are 10 and 5. The LCD is 10.
2. Adjust the fractions:
- $\frac{1}{10}$ remains $\frac{1}{10}$.
- $\frac{3}{5} = \frac{3 \times 2}{5 \times 2} = \frac{6}{10}$
3. Add the numerators:
$$
\frac{1}{10} + \frac{6}{10} = \frac{1 + 6}{10} = \frac{7}{10}
$$
4. Simplify: $\frac{7}{10}$ is already in simplest form.

Answer: $\frac{7}{10}$

---

Problem 7: $\frac{4}{5} + \frac{1}{7}$



1. Find the LCD: The denominators are 5 and 7. The LCD is 35.
2. Adjust the fractions:
- $\frac{4}{5} = \frac{4 \times 7}{5 \times 7} = \frac{28}{35}$
- $\frac{1}{7} = \frac{1 \times 5}{7 \times 5} = \frac{5}{35}$
3. Add the numerators:
$$
\frac{28}{35} + \frac{5}{35} = \frac{28 + 5}{35} = \frac{33}{35}
$$
4. Simplify: $\frac{33}{35}$ is already in simplest form.

Answer: $\frac{33}{35}$

---

Problem 8: $\frac{3}{9} + \frac{1}{5}$



1. Find the LCD: The denominators are 9 and 5. The LCD is 45.
2. Adjust the fractions:
- $\frac{3}{9} = \frac{3 \times 5}{9 \times 5} = \frac{15}{45}$
- $\frac{1}{5} = \frac{1 \times 9}{5 \times 9} = \frac{9}{45}$
3. Add the numerators:
$$
\frac{15}{45} + \frac{9}{45} = \frac{15 + 9}{45} = \frac{24}{45}
$$
4. Simplify: $\frac{24}{45} = \frac{8}{15}$.

Answer: $\frac{8}{15}$

---

Problem 9: $\frac{2}{7} + \frac{3}{4}$



1. Find the LCD: The denominators are 7 and 4. The LCD is 28.
2. Adjust the fractions:
- $\frac{2}{7} = \frac{2 \times 4}{7 \times 4} = \frac{8}{28}$
- $\frac{3}{4} = \frac{3 \times 7}{4 \times 7} = \frac{21}{28}$
3. Add the numerators:
$$
\frac{8}{28} + \frac{21}{28} = \frac{8 + 21}{28} = \frac{29}{28}
$$
4. Simplify: $\frac{29}{28}$ is already in simplest form.

Answer: $\frac{29}{28}$

---

Problem 10: $\frac{1}{12} + \frac{3}{8}$



1. Find the LCD: The denominators are 12 and 8. The LCD is 24.
2. Adjust the fractions:
- $\frac{1}{12} = \frac{1 \times 2}{12 \times 2} = \frac{2}{24}$
- $\frac{3}{8} = \frac{3 \times 3}{8 \times 3} = \frac{9}{24}$
3. Add the numerators:
$$
\frac{2}{24} + \frac{9}{24} = \frac{2 + 9}{24} = \frac{11}{24}
$$
4. Simplify: $\frac{11}{24}$ is already in simplest form.

Answer: $\frac{11}{24}$

---

Problem 11: $\frac{1}{8} + \frac{5}{5}$



1. Simplify $\frac{5}{5}$: $\frac{5}{5} = 1$.
2. Add: $\frac{1}{8} + 1 = \frac{1}{8} + \frac{8}{8} = \frac{1 + 8}{8} = \frac{9}{8}$.

Answer: $\frac{9}{8}$

---

Problem 12: $\frac{4}{5} + \frac{8}{10}$



1. Simplify $\frac{8}{10}$: $\frac{8}{10} = \frac{4}{5}$.
2. Add: $\frac{4}{5} + \frac{4}{5} = \frac{4 + 4}{5} = \frac{8}{5}$.

Answer: $\frac{8}{5}$

---

Problem 13: $\frac{9}{10} + \frac{4}{5}$



1. Find the LCD: The denominators are 10 and 5. The LCD is 10.
2. Adjust the fractions:
- $\frac{9}{10}$ remains $\frac{9}{10}$.
- $\frac{4}{5} = \frac{4 \times 2}{5 \times 2} = \frac{8}{10}$
3. Add the numerators:
$$
\frac{9}{10} + \frac{8}{10} = \frac{9 + 8}{10} = \frac{17}{10}
$$
4. Simplify: $\frac{17}{10}$ is already in simplest form.

Answer: $\frac{17}{10}$

---

Problem 14: $\frac{3}{12} + \frac{2}{4}$



1. Simplify $\frac{3}{12}$: $\frac{3}{12} = \frac{1}{4}$.
2. Simplify $\frac{2}{4}$: $\frac{2}{4} = \frac{1}{2}$.
3. Find the LCD: The denominators are 4 and 2. The LCD is 4.
4. Adjust the fractions:
- $\frac{1}{4}$ remains $\frac{1}{4}$.
- $\frac{1}{2} = \frac{1 \times 2}{2 \times 2} = \frac{2}{4}$
5. Add the numerators:
$$
\frac{1}{4} + \frac{2}{4} = \frac{1 + 2}{4} = \frac{3}{4}
$$

Answer: $\frac{3}{4}$

---

Problem 15: $\frac{3}{7} + \frac{2}{8}$



1. Simplify $\frac{2}{8}$: $\frac{2}{8} = \frac{1}{4}$.
2. Find the LCD: The denominators are 7 and 4. The LCD is 28.
3. Adjust the fractions:
- $\frac{3}{7} = \frac{3 \times 4}{7 \times 4} = \frac{12}{28}$
- $\frac{1}{4} = \frac{1 \times 7}{4 \times 7} = \frac{7}{28}$
4. Add the numerators:
$$
\frac{12}{28} + \frac{7}{28} = \frac{12 + 7}{28} = \frac{19}{28}
$$
5. Simplify: $\frac{19}{28}$ is already in simplest form.

Answer: $\frac{19}{28}$
